North Irvine is the city's "gateway to the great outdoors." Within the
Northern Sphere's boundaries, there are more than 4,600 acres
slated for open space preservation and 1,085 acres in open space
recreation or other open space. Building upon the City's historic
Open Space Agreement of 1988, this plan has a phased dedication
program for the associated open space to be permanently preserved.
The Northern Sphere plan incorporates new open space implementation
districts that will ensure the dedication of preserved open space for
perpetual public ownership as lands designated for development are
built. This northern open space will be linked to the city's open
space in the southern region by the Jeffrey Open Space
Trail - a recreation and open space corridor park located along
Jeffrey Road.
The Northern Sphere plan also contains a significant community park
program which will complete the city's park system by providing
a balance of active sports facilities - lighted and unlighted -
needed park buildings, and opportunities for embarking on nature
walks in the northern open space regions.
